BAU: A man lodged a police report after receiving threats from his father-in-law at Kampung Pangkalan Loji.

Bau district police chief Supt Mohd Haide A Rahman said the report was received on Sept 3 at around 12.34am from a man in his 30s.

“According to the report, the incident happened on Sept 2 at around 9pm when the suspect, believed to be intoxicated, caused a disturbance in the house.

“The suspect became enraged after being confronted by the complainant and family members, before verbally threatening them, threatening he would kill them in their sleep and set fire to the house.

“The suspect also punched a living room wall,” he said.

Further investigation revealed that the suspect frequently returned home intoxicated and caused disturbances by breaking items in the house. However, previous incidents were never reported to the police.

“Following the report, we detained the 40-year-old suspect, who is the father of the complainant’s wife,” said Mohd Haide.

The case is being investigated under Section 506 of the Penal Code and Section 18A of the Domestic Violence Act 1994 (AKRT 1994).
